Role Overview

The Senior System Support Specialist is a critical part of our Healthcare IT team, specializing in Radiology Information Systems (RIS), Picture Archiving and Communication Systems (PACS), and other medical imaging solutions. The ideal candidate will provide technical support and troubleshooting for radiology IT systems in hospitals, clinics, and imaging centers. This role involves working closely with radiologists, IT teams, and vendors to ensure optimal system performance, uptime, and compliance with healthcare regulations.

Key Responsibilities

  • Deliver expert technical support across radiology IT environments, diagnosing and resolving issues within RIS, PACS, VNA, and related systems to minimize downtime and protect continuity of patient care.
  • Ensure seamless healthcare system integration by applying DICOM, HL7, and other interoperability standards, and by partnering with radiologists, technologists, and IT teams to optimize clinical workflows.
  • Maintain data integrity and regulatory compliance by handling sensitive patient information in accordance with applicable privacy regulations, U.S. FDA medical device requirements, and ISO 13485 quality standards.
  • Build and sustain a strong knowledge base by documenting all troubleshooting activities, resolutions, and case records accurately, and by developing and maintaining technical documentation that empowers customers toeffectively use and maintain Intelerad products.
  • Support operational readiness and resilience by contributing to disaster recovery planning and backup strategies, participating in on-call rotations as required, and collaborating cross-functionally to resolve complex technical challenges

Qualifications

Qualifications & Experience

  • Bachelor’s degree in computer engineering or a related field, or equivalent experience.
  • 3+ years of experience in Healthcare IT, preferably in radiology systems support.
  • Excellent troubleshooting, analytical, and problem-solving skills.
  • Strong communication skills with the ability to interact with both technical and clinical personnel.
  • Ability to work independently and man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ment
  • Experience with ticketing systems such as Salesforce ServiceCloud, ZenDesk, or ServiceNow (ServiceNow preferred).
  • Strong knowledge of PACS, RIS, VNA, and medical imaging workflows.
  • Experience with DICOM, HL7, IHE, and other healthcare interoperability standards.
  • Proficiency in Windows OS (Microsoft Server 2012, 2016, 2019, 2022+), networking, SQL Server, and/or Oracle.
  • Understanding of medical informatics architecture, including VMware and storage solutions.
  • Working knowledge of Linux architecture.
  • Experience with PostgreSQL.
  • Understanding of cybersecurity best practices and HIPAA compliance.

Preferred Qualifications & Special Requirements

  • Industry certifications in relevant technical domains (e.g., Microsoft, VMware, Cisco).
  • Red Hat Certified System Administrator (RHCSA) certification.
  • Experience in scripting or automation for system administration (PowerShell, Bash, Python).
  • Knowledge of cloud-based medical imaging solutions and telemedicine technologies.
  • Fluency in multiple languages (French is a strong asset).
